Destructorlio wrote...

From The Arrival: “Kenson’s acting strange lately. Like she doesn’t care about the Project anymore. And I know I’m not the only one having those dreams. The Reapers are coming she says. But I’m not sure if I’m hearing fear or hope in her voice.”

http://masseffect.wi...val_(assignment)

From ME2: “Chandana said the ship was dead. We trusted him. He was right. But even a dead god can dream. A god — a real god — is a verb. Not some old man with magic powers. It's a force. It warps reality just by being there. It doesn't have to want to. It doesn't have to think about it. It just does. That's what Chandana didn't get. Not until it was too late. The god's mind is gone but it still dreams. He knows now. He's tuned in on our dreams. If I close my eyes I can feel him. I can feel every one of us.”

http://masseffect.wi...wiki/Reaper_IFF

Are there any other dream/indoctrination links in the game?


From The Arrival: "I woke up this morning in a cold sweat. The nightmare was back, the one with the enormous starship crawling through the Citadel and all my friends turning to dust. Even now I can see it in my mind. Why won’t this stop?”

-Possibly from the same scientist in your first quote.


Hm, that nightmare he describes is the same as Arrival's "out of time" game over alternate ending. If we assume that ending is Shepard's perspective, then that's defintiely a mark of indoctrination on Shepards mind BUT only if you played through Arrival.
